The ring of bells at Allesley has been improved by replacing several ancient bells. The 3rd and 4th bells were replaced with newly cast bells in 2011 and during 2016 the 6th bell was replaced by a bell from the redundant church of Holy Trinity, Bury, Gtr. Manchester.  Enjoy! Note: Read more…
